Looking through an alternate lens of depression, this blog includes trying to get through depression using the refined art of gratitude and gratefulness. It also includes skills I've learned and how I'm trying to apply them (please note the keyword of "trying"). Additionally, thoughts about my day, family, work, things I like and don't like, etc will be jotted down.
The most important aspect of this blog is that it allows me to express myself with no fear.
